Transaction 7848578111312d9c46edca416a09166b01b5cac61b368a9d2d8c92e59cb20c69

6 Input
1 Outputs
  • 7848578111312d9c46edca416a09166b01b5cac61b368a9d2d8c92e59cb20c69:0
  • value  496069011
    address  15cxBdcNYsdkTW6JoM3Q4xshRF6x8vYrEc